Cerro El Picacho
Cerro El Picacho is a mountain in Guanaceví Municipality, Durango and has an elevation of 2,473 metres. Cerro El Picacho is situated nearby to the locality San Antonio, as well as near the hamlet Los Bajíos.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Guanaceví
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Guanaceví is a small town in northwestern Durango, Mexico. It is a small town with limited tourist appeal, but with a population of about 2,900, it's large enough to provide basic traveler services like gas stations and food.
